Settlement of Accounts, with details

Description

Finley and Cornwall's account considered by Simmons. Col. Rochefontaine noted Freeman regarding issue, Simmons declared it by no means facilitated settlement. After considering every point of view, Simmons deducted $9.40 from account, remaining balance: $29.60. Simmons requests Freeman pay the parties with the unappropriated monies in his hands after acquisition of appropriate receipts. Account materials were reinclosed by Simmons to Freeman.
